Serving It Up
    The Golden Eagles currently rank second in the league in service aces with 54 this season. Brittany Looker (So., OH, Rochester, Minn.) has been a huge part of that success as she currently leads in the entire NSIC in service aces with 16. Alexandra Skeeter (Jr., OH, Milwaukee, Wis.) has 11 service aces this season while Paige Mitchell (R-Jr., S, West Palm Beach, Fla.) has eight.

Leave It To Looker
    Through seven games, Brittany Looker (So., OH, Rochester, Minn.) already has three double-doubles this season. She has 10 kills and 16 digs versus Shippensburg, 16 kills and 15 digs against Ferris State and 12 kills and 11 digs against Northern Michigan. In addition, Looker was named to the all-tournament team for the second week in a row earning the honor at the UMD Classic.

Skeeter Stepping Up
    Alexandra Skeeter (Jr., OH, Milwaukee, Wis.) has took an added role with the squad this season. After starting only five games in 2011 and accumulating 86 kills and averaging 1.41 kills per set, Skeeter is already second on the team with 51 kills and is averaging 2.22 kills per set through seven games so far this season. She has started six of seven matches this season.

Wiesner and Looker Named All-Tournament
    University of Minnesota, Crookston volleyball players Chelsea Wiesner (Jr., Lib., Rochester, Minn.) and Brittany Looker (So., OH, Rochester, Minn.) were among 13 players selected to the Ferris State Invitational All-Tournament team following a strong showing by the Golden Eagles at the tournament. Wiesner accumulated 56 digs for an average of 4.00 digs per set for the Golden Eagles on the weekend while Looker had 32 kills for an average of 2.67 kills per set. Looker also had 10 service aces and 30 digs for an average of 2.50 digs per set.

Wiesner Surpasses 1,000 Digs
    In two seasons, Chelsea Wiesner (Jr., Lib., Rochester, Minn.), has accumulated  1,045 digs. Wiesner is just 466 digs away from Jaclyn Slepicka's school record at the University of Minnesota, Crookston. Wiesner has two seasons to meet the mark after picking up 562 digs as a sophomore last season. Wiesner is one of just three players in school history with over 1,000 digs joining Slepicka and Joan Ebnet.

•  Turning It Around
    The Golden Eagles had a major turnaround last season after going 12-16 following an 0-28 season in 2010. UMC will continue to look to build on last season's improvement as they return a strong core from last season's group and add in several new components that look to help the program take the next step.

Top-Notch Competition
    UMC will once again go up against the top NCAA Division II competition in the nation as the NSIC boasts six teams in the AVCA Top 25 poll including Concordia-St. Paul, the five-time consecutive NCAA National Champion returns four AVCA All-American picks to the team heading into 2012. In addition, Southwest Minnesota State and Minnesota Duluth are ranked in the top 10.

The Scoop

Minnesota, Crookston

    The University of Minnesota, Crookston have come out of the first two weekends of play with a 4-3 overall mark on the season as they have wins against Shippensburg University, Clarion University, Alderson-Broaddus College and Glenville State University. UMC's losses have come to No. 4 University of Minnesota Duluth, No. 19 Ferris State University and Northern Michigan University.

    The Golden Eagles have been led this season by Brittany Looker (So., OH, Rochester, Minn.), who is coming off of a All-NSIC Honorable Mention pick as a freshman. Looker has picked up three double-doubles already this year and leads the team in kills with 59 and service aces with 16. She is second on the team in digs with 64. On the offensive side, Alexandra Skeeter (Jr., OH, Milwaukee, Wis.) has stepped it up so far this year and is second on the team in kills with 51 and is averaging 2.22 kills per set. Defensively, Skeeter is third on the squad in digs with 59.

    At setter, Paige Mitchell (R-Jr., S, West Palm Beach, Fla.) and Lindsey Rees (R-Jr., S, Bronson, Mich.) have shared the duties with Mitchell averaging 4.38 assists per set and Rees averaging 4.17 assists per set.

    Defensively, Chelsea Wiesner (Jr., Lib., Rochester, Minn.) leads the team and is currently sixth in the conference averaging 4.42 digs per set. Alyssa Schneider (Jr., MH, Racine, Wis.) currently leads the team averaging 0.75 blocks per set.

    The Golden Eagles have overall been competitive in tough matches this year but have let one set put the tone entire match in their losses this season. Against UMD, after an okay first set, UMC hit -.088 in the second set and lost 25-12. Versus Ferris State, the Golden Eagles hit -.103 in the first set but bounced back to be competitive in set two and dominate set three before losing set four. Against Northern Michigan, UMC played a pretty balanced overall match.

U-Mary

    U-Mary comes into the weekend with an overall mark of 0-7. The Marauders competed at the Black Hills State Tournament last weekend and suffered losses to Colorado Christian University, Augustana College (S.D.), Chadron State College and Black Hills State University. Steve Novacek is in his third season as the head coach of the Marauders.

    U-Mary is struggling this season on offense as they are only hitting .064 on the season and allowing the opposition to hit .215. Offensively, the squad has been led by the 2.78 kills per set from 6-0 outside hitter  Alexis Jacobs. Setter Emily Turkowski comes in averaging 7.83 assists per set.

    Defensively, the Marauders are led by Valerie Lesu's 4.08 digs per set while Allison Adams, 1 6-0 middle blocker, comes in averaging 0.91 blocks per set.

Minot State
   
    Minot State University enters the weekend with a record of 3-6. The Beavers' three wins came against Black Hills State University, Valley City State University and Chadron State College. Minot State is coached by second-year head coach Travis Ward and are entering their first weekend as members of the NSIC as they face Bemidji State and Minnesota, Crookston this weekend.

    The Beavers come into the weekend hitting .117 as a team and allowing their foes to hit .216. On offense, Minot State is led by 6-0 freshman outside hitter Mallory Sall, who is averaging 3.35 kills per set. Setter Emily Byrne comes in averaging 8.00 assists per set.

    Defensively, the Beavers are paced by the 3.29 digs per set by Ashley Heavenor and the 0.60 blocks per set by Erin Davis.
